About This Book

Bright shapes and bold colors flash across the page as you lift the flap to find surprises hiding underneath. Objects pop out in reds, blues, and yellows—can you spot which one doesn’t belong? The fun is just beginning when the flap snaps back down!

Quick Assessment

This tactile board book introduces early readers to colors through vibrant illustrations and interactive lift-the-flap elements. Designed for children ages 5 to 8, it encourages observation and vocabulary development while engaging young learners with playful challenges. The sturdy pages make it a durable choice for repeated exploration.
